Finnish public broadcaster seeks reader questions about drones entering Finnish airspace
Finnish public broadcaster Yle is asking readers to submit questions about drones that have entered the country’s airspace, following two incidents on Sunday.
The Finnish Defence Forces identified one of the drones as Ukrainian. Retired engineer colonel and non-fiction author Jyri Kosola assessed that a second drone, which entered airspace in southeastern Finland, had exploded.
Yle has opened a form for readers to submit queries about the drones, their origins, and their implications for Finnish airspace security.
